About Cranncheol

Cranncheol Publishing is an independent publisher with a focus on ecological, social justice, and spiritual themes. We publish fiction, nonfiction, and poetry of any genre that is inspired by these themes. However, our emphasis is on speculative fiction. This includes climate fiction, science fiction, fantasy, horror, weird fiction, supernatural fiction, superhero fiction, utopian and dystopian fiction, apocalyptic and post-apocalyptic fiction, and alternate history.

Fun Facts

Cranncheol was founded on May 8, 2013. This date was chosen to commemorate the Inland Hurricane of May 8, 2009.

“Cranncheol” means “Treesong” in Irish (Gaeilge). It was named after our founder and first published author, Treesong.
